Output 14383f39fa5eb9d1b89c04041ebc22910e6ff1d90731498315496c5dbe09b632:1

value
20623559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8124bcabd9aea1d8e2d8d9a5a568385a5a00db51 OP_EQUAL
address
MKg1QhziTCcw7rcS4okEKNBQ61P8FbWVgq
transaction
14383f39fa5eb9d1b89c04041ebc22910e6ff1d90731498315496c5dbe09b632
spent
true